Quillan Salkilld Updates on Knee Injury After UFC Vegas 120 Victory
Quillan Salkilld has provided an update on his knee injury sustained during his fight against Mateusz Gamrot at UFC Vegas 120. The Australian lightweight achieved a significant victory by submitting Gamrot in the first round, improving his UFC record to 6-0 and entering the top six of the lightweight division.
During the match, Salkilld felt a pop in his knee during a wrestling exchange, raising concerns about the injury. However, he later confirmed that scans revealed no serious damage, attributing the soreness to the initial wrestling exchange rather than the leg lock attempt by Gamrot.
Looking ahead, Salkilld expressed interest in facing Paddy Pimblett next, aiming for a high-profile fight in New York. Both fighters are coming off significant wins, making this matchup a potential title eliminator in the lightweight division.
